China based Xiamen Airlines is set to launch new flights to Qatar.
It will start Doha flights from Beijing Daxing Airport on October 20.
It will also launch Xiamen-Doha flights on October 31.
The opening of two direct routes coincides with the 35th anniversary of diplomatic relations between China and Qatar.
The Beijing-Doha route will operate daily, while Xiamen-Doha flights will run twice weekly.
Both routes will be operated by Boeing 787 Dreamliner aircraft.
Doha’s Hamad International Airport was named one of the top ten airports globally in 2023.
Xiamen Airlines will also cooperate with Qatar Airways on full network interlining and codeshare flights.
Leveraging this, Xiamen Airlines can effectively expand its network to over 160 global destinations with through ticketing.
